3. Diagnostic CPV−DI02 (PROFIBUS−DP)
Système de
commande
SIMATIC S5 avec
S5−95U/maître DP
SIMATIC S7/M7
Tab. 3/19 : Possibilités de lire le diagnostic pour l'automate S7
Langage STL
CALL SFC 13
REQ:=TRUE
LADDR:=W#16#03FE
RET_VAL:=MW100
RECORD:=P#M110.0 WORD 5 Pointeur au début de la plage de données relative au diagnostic
BUSY:=M10.0
Fig. 3/4 : Exemple
3−22
Possibilités de lire le diagnostic pour l'automate S7
Le diagnostic du bus de terrain PROFIBUS−DP est obtenu dans
les différents systèmes de commande à l'aide des modules
fonctionnels. Ces derniers lisent le diagnostic d'esclave et
l'écrivent dans une plage de données du programme utilisateur.
Module fonctionnel
FB 230 S_DIAG"
SFC 13 DP NRM_DG"
Exemple de programme utilisateur STEP 7
Explication
Demande de lecture
Pointeur sur l'adresse de diagnostic, p. ex. 1022
(voir masque Properties DP slave" dans le HW Config)
En cas d'erreurs, Édition du code d'erreur
et longueur des données de diagnostic
Lecture terminée
Voir...
Manuel Périphérie
décentralisée ET 200"
Manuel de référence Fonctions
standard et fonctions du
système"
Construc
teurs
Siemens
Siemens
= 03FE
d
h
Festo P.BE−CPV−DI02−F R fr 0704NH